fix(doctor): implement Fix for misclassified-wisps check (#878)

The misclassified-wisps check could detect issues that should be wisps
but couldn't fix them because bd update lacked an --ephemeral flag.

Now that beads supports `bd update <id> --ephemeral` (steveyegge/beads#1263),
implement the actual fix to mark detected issues as ephemeral.

Closes #852
